AJ06 DYP is a 2006 Renault Grand Scenic in Black with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.7%.
Across all 2006 Renault Grand Scenic models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.3% with a typical mileage of 69,368 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Grand Scenic f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 39,444 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AJ06 DYP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Grand Scenic typ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this Renault Grand Scenic is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
